His name is SoMo. I met him while on a trek to Namtso Lake in Tibet.  I had wanted to travel to Tibet for years and when I discovered the Chinese were creating a railroad that would lead directly into Lhasa and once that happened I knew things would never be the same and time was of the essence if I wanted to experience the real Tibet.

I set out from the United States of America and landed in Beijing, then on to Chengdu and eventually arrived in Lhasa by plane. I met some fellow backpackers that were planning a small trek to Namtso Lake in the north and they were looking for a 4th companion to share experience with.  I agreed and joined them.  So much happened on that journey, I have so many images to share but will start with this sweet Tibetan boy named SoMo.  We could barely communicate verbally, but that didn’t matter, we understood, each other. This image was taken after we climbed a big hill overlooking part of the lake and camp. I remember it like it was yesterday. This boy touched my soul. #sonjarevellsphotography
